How Much Water Is Needed To Use Pure Power Blue In RV Holding Tanks?
Updated 09/14/2020 | Published 09/10/2020 >
Question:
How much water should we use when we use the toilet for optimal pure power blue . Thanks
asked by: Tim J
Expert Reply:
Each pouch in the Pure Power Blue Treatment for RV Holding Tanks - Fresh Clean Scent - Drop In Pouches - Qty 12 Item # V23015 treats up to a 40 gallon tank. It is recommended that after you drain your tank to add some water back into your tank before putting in a pouch. There is not set amount that needs to be in the tank. I recommend letting the water run into your tank for about 10-15 seconds then add the pouch. This allows the pouch plenty of time to dilute and mix.
